Round 7, Pick: Shamar Stephen, Defensive Tackle, Connecticut
As a Connecticut football fan, I have watched Shamar Stephen for many years. The man with two first names plays with a ton of energy that I love. At 6’5″, 325 pounds, Stephen is also a big body that could take on double teams. The Cowboys will most likely not bring back Jason Hatcher, and Nick Hayden is just bad. This leaves them with holes at the defensive tackle position. The Cowboys have Ben Bass, but he has barely played in his NFL career. In my opinion, the Cowboys would benefit greatly by getting two defensive tackles in this year’s draft. In a 4-3 defense, you want a fast defensive tackle and a strong defensive tackle. Donald could be the fast guy, and Stephen could be the guy to clog the middle.
